mysql如何修改字段类型

文 / @WordPress主题

MySQL是一款常用的关系型数据库管理系统,用于存储、管理和查询数据。当我们在使用MySQL时,可能会遇到需要修改字段类型的情况。比如当我们需要将一个字段的数据类型从int修改为varchar时,应该怎么操作呢?

本文就将针对MySQL如何修改字段类型进行详细介绍。我们将通过一个实例来演示具体的操作步骤。假设我们有一个名为“student”的表,其中包含id和name两个字段,其中name字段的数据类型为int。

1. 登录MySQL

首先,我们需要在电脑上打开MySQL客户端,连接到MySQL服务器。在本次操作中,我们使用的是windows7系统,MySQL的版本为8,DellG3电脑。打开MySQL客户端后,输入用户名和密码,登录MySQL。

2. 查看表的结构

在登录MySQL后,我们需要查看一下要修改的表的结构,确定具体要修改的字段名称和数据类型。可以使用以下的SQL语句查询表的结构:

describe student;

3. 修改字段类型

在查看完表的结构后,我们就可以进行字段类型的修改了。我们将把name字段的数据类型从int修改为varchar类型,长度为20。具体的操作步骤如下:

alter table student alter column name varchar(20) not null;

这是一段SQL语句,它将对student表的name字段进行修改。alter table student表示要修改的表名为student;alter column name表示要修改的字段名称为name;varchar(20)表示修改后的字段类型为varchar,长度为20;not null表示该字段不允许为空。

4. 验证修改结果

完成修改后,我们需要再次查看表的结构,以验证修改是否成功。可以使用以下SQL语句查看表的结构:

describe student;

如果修改成功,将会看到输出结果中name字段的数据类型为varchar(20)。

到此为止,我们已经成功地将MySQL中的一个字段的数据类型从int修改为varchar(20)了。通过这个实例,相信大家在实际操作中也能轻松完成MySQL字段类型的修改。如果需要进行其他类型的修改,方法也是类似的。祝大家使用愉快!

添加UTHEME为好友
扫码添加UTHEME微信为好友
· 分享WordPress相关技术文章,主题上新与优惠动态早知道。
· 微信端最大WordPress社群,限时免费入群。